Presentation Transcript


  1. Pepita Talks Twice Vocabulary

  2. Spanish a language Pepita speaks to Lobo in Spanish.

  3. grumble a complaint; to complain Sue did not grumble about all of the homework she had to do.

  4. tiptoed walked quietly Matt did not want to scare the deer; so he tiptoed across the log.

  5. ducked lowered one’s head and body to avoid being seen by others

  6. tortilla a round, flat Mexican bread

  7. enchiladas tortillas rolled around a filling, then covered with spicy sauce

  8. tamales meat or fruit filling rolled in cornmeal dough, wrapped in cornhusk, then steamed

  9. tacos tortillas folded around meat, cheese, and vegetables

  10. salsa a spicy sauce usually made of tomatoes, onions, and peppers

  11. language spoken or written human speech

  12. mumbled said softly and unclearly Timmy mumbled, “I love you Grandma.”

  13. darted moved suddenly and very quickly

  14. nuzzled rubbed gently; snuggled close
